Thermal energy transfer from high temperature to low temperature. The cause of transfer is the temperature difference.
Heat can only be transferred if there IS a temperature difference. (If two objects have the same temperature, nothing will happen).
Sensible heat is heat supplied or taken away and causes an immediate change in temperature without changing the state. While latent heat is heat supplied or taken away and causes a change in state without change in temperature. This difference can be applied to the certain properties of water/steam. This is called the thermodynamics properties of steam.
